Category

14368

You can

27469

Payments

59255
Online Visa Payments in 196 countries

Visa in 196 countries 100% ✓Money Back Guarantee.【Best】Visa online mobile recharge website. Instant Delivery in 196 countries. Pay online with Bitcoin or use other 16+ payment methods.